Bolivia

Although Chambers is aware of the overlap with Projects and project financing, the energy chapters principally focus on regulatory issues arising from the energy sector. These include the regulatory components of M&A and other transactional work, pure regulatory work related to the application for licenses and compliance and enforcement with regulatory bodies. We also consider the buying and selling of energy assets.

    Dentons Guevara & Gutiérrez S.C.
    Energy & Natural Resources
    2024 | Band 1 | 16 Years Ranked
    Dentons Guevara & Gutiérrez offers a stellar department that maintains its position at the forefront of the market. The team has a standout track record of advising key domestic and international players on sophisticated regulatory matters, possessing notable expertise in energy distribution mandates. Its deep bench of acclaimed practitioners is regularly called upon to assist with compliance components of joint ventures between private and public entities within the energy sector. The department provides additional strength in due diligence on issues relating to hydrocarbons.

    Moreno Baldivieso
    Energy & Natural Resources
    2024 | Band 1 | 16 Years Ranked
    Moreno Baldivieso houses a market-leading energy practice well versed in advising prestigious regional and international companies on the full spectrum of mandates. With a multi-city base, the team possesses notable skills in negotiating distribution agreements, in addition to high-stakes public-private investment and significant project finance operations, including developing wind farms and gas fields. The department is also well equipped to assist with licensing processes and regulatory compliance relating to nuclear energy matters. Thyssenkrupp and Andean Precious Metals are two recent client wins.

    Bufete Aguirre, Quintanilla, Soria & Nishizawa Sociedad Civil - BAQSN
    Energy & Natural Resources
    2024 | Band 2 | 16 Years Ranked
    Bufete Aguirre, Quintanilla, Soria & Nishizawa's dynamic practice offers considerable experience in mining concessions and hydrocarbon operations. With offices in Santa Cruz and La Paz, the department's range of services extends to corporate restructuring and transactional advice within the energy and natural resources arena. The team is often sought out by key local players in the oil and gas sector to provide counsel on regulatory compliance matters.

    Indacochea & Asociados
    Energy & Natural Resources
    2024 | Band 2 | 16 Years Ranked
    Indacochea & Asociados' respected Santa Cruz-based energy department has an impressive track record in the Bolivian market. The team is routinely retained by well-reputed actors in the oil and gas sector to assist with contractual analysis, distribution matters and general corporate advice. The department is also sought out to act on contentious mandates within the energy sphere.

    PPO Abogados
    Energy & Natural Resources
    2024 | Band 3 | 6 Years Ranked
    PPO Abogados possesses an established energy and natural resources practice. The team boasts experience handling the regulatory components of public-private joint ventures in the mining sector. The department is also well regarded for advising on project finance mandates, negotiating distribution agreements and commercial matters. Whitehorse Gold, Uranium One and Cartier Silver are recent additions to the firm's client roster.
